Analysis

In 2025, population ages 50-54, female in Saint Kitts and Nevis stood at 6.6%.

That represents a change of up 0.3% on the previous year and up 0.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 50-54, female in Saint Kitts and Nevis peaked at 7.0% in 2011 and was at its lowest, 2.7%, in 1988.

Saint Kitts and Nevis ranks 62nd of 218 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 66 years of available data.

Population ages 50-54, female in Saint Kitts and Nevis, year by year

Annual values for Population ages 50-54, female (% of female population) in Saint Kitts and Nevis, 1960 to 2025.
Year % of female population Change
1960 4.3%
1961 4.4% +1.4%
1962 4.5% +1.3%
1963 4.5% +0.6%
1964 4.5% +0.3%
1965 4.5% -0.4%
1966 4.4% -1.3%
1967 4.3% -1.8%
1968 4.2% -2.4%
1969 4.1% -2.7%
1970 4.0% -2.0%
1971 4.0% -1.3%
1972 3.9% -1.4%
1973 3.9% -1.4%
1974 3.8% -1.5%
1975 3.8% -1.6%
1976 3.7% -1.7%
1977 3.6% -1.7%
1978 3.6% -2.0%
1979 3.5% -2.3%
1980 3.4% -2.0%
1981 3.3% -1.9%
1982 3.3% -2.3%
1983 3.2% -2.8%
1984 3.1% -3.0%
1985 3.0% -3.3%
1986 2.9% -3.4%
1987 2.8% -3.1%
1988 2.7% -1.5%
1989 2.7% +0.1%
1990 2.8% +0.7%
1991 2.8% +1.0%
1992 2.8% -0.1%
1993 2.8% -0.6%
1994 2.8% -0.0%
1995 2.8% +0.2%
1996 2.8% -0.1%
1997 2.8% +1.4%
1998 2.9% +2.4%
1999 3.0% +3.1%
2000 3.2% +6.5%
2001 3.4% +8.1%
2002 3.7% +8.0%
2003 4.0% +8.6%
2004 4.4% +9.0%
2005 4.7% +8.5%
2006 5.1% +7.8%
2007 5.5% +7.8%
2008 6.0% +8.5%
2009 6.5% +7.8%
2010 6.8% +5.5%
2011 7.0% +2.3%
2012 6.9% -0.8%
2013 6.7% -2.5%
2014 6.6% -2.3%
2015 6.5% -0.5%
2016 6.6% +0.6%
2017 6.6% -0.2%
2018 6.5% -1.1%
2019 6.4% -1.8%
2020 6.3% -1.6%
2021 6.3% -0.2%
2022 6.4% +1.6%
2023 6.5% +1.6%
2024 6.5% +1.0%
2025 6.6% +0.3%
